Advent begins on November 30th. Advent is the four weeks before Christmas. In the church year, Advent is a season of preparation and repentance. Advent focuses on the coming of Christ and of his return. During Advent, we’re anticipating the full realization of something that began at the first Christmas when God came to us in the flesh as Emmanuel. The work of Advent began then, but isn’t yet fully realized.
Each week, we’ll light a candle on the Advent wreath and center on the theme of “Heaven and Nature Sing” from the beloved Christmas carol “Joy to the World”.
Composer Isaac Watt’s interpretation of Psalm 98 invites us to sing a “new song”–and it is a powerful cosmic performance of all creation being renewed and freed. Rather than “joy” being yet another word for “happiness,” we will discover that the depths of joy can be found especially in the midst of suffering, the work of justice, and the presence of compassion–all part of the coming of Jesus to this world and a message the world still so desperately needs.
